Odisha, also known as the land of temples, is a beautiful state in eastern India. It is known for its rich cultural heritage, beautiful beaches, and stunning architecture. Summer is a great time to visit Odisha as the weather is pleasant, and there are many exciting places to explore. Here are some of the best places to visit in Odisha in summer:

Table of Contents

Puri Beach:

Puri Beach is one of the most famous beaches in Odisha and is a must-visit during the summer. The beach is known for its beautiful golden sand and clear blue waters. It is also famous for the Jagannath Temple, which is located nearby.

Konark Sun Temple:

The Konark Sun Temple is a UNESCO World Heritage site and is a marvel of architecture. The temple is dedicated to the sun god and is shaped like a chariot with 12 wheels, each representing a month of the year.

Chilika Lake:

Chilika Lake is the largest saltwater lake in Asia, home to various migratory birds. It is a great place to visit during the summer as the weather is pleasant, and you can enjoy a boat ride on the lake.

Dhauli Hill:

Dhauli Hill is a historic site on Bhubaneswar’s outskirts. It is believed to be where Emperor Ashoka gave up his violent ways and embraced Buddhism. The hill offers beautiful views of the surrounding area and is an excellent place for a picnic.

Udayagiri and Khandagiri Caves:

The Udayagiri and Khandagiri Caves are ancient rock-cut caves near Bhubaneswar. The caves are famous for their beautiful carvings and sculptures and are great places to explore during the summer.

Simlipal National Park:

Simlipal National Park is a famous wildlife sanctuary in the Mayurbhanj district. It is home to various animals, including tigers, elephants, and leopards. The park is a great place to visit during the summer months as the weather is pleasant, and you can enjoy a safari ride through the park.

Daringbadi:

Daringbadi is a beautiful hill station located in the Kandhamal district. It is known as the “Kashmir of Odisha” and is famous for its scenic beauty and pleasant weather. The hill station is a great place to visit during the summer, and you can enjoy activities such as trekking and camping.

Hirakud Dam:

Hirakud Dam is one of the longest dams in the world and is located in the Sambalpur district. The dam is a marvel of engineering and is a great place to visit during the summer, as you can enjoy boating and other water sports.

In conclusion, Odisha has a lot to offer during the summer, and these are some of the best places to visit. Whether you are interested in history, culture, or wildlife or want to relax on the beach, there is something for everyone in Odisha.
